Physician Associate

1 month ago


Manchester, United Kingdom Miles Platting, Newton Heath and Moston PCN Full time

Job summary

This is an exciting opportunity to work within primary care whilstdelivering innovative care to the wider community. The role offers anopportunity for a physician associate to develop as a primary careclinician.

The physician associate will work within a GP surgery to deliveryacute and chronic disease management. As part of the wider multidisciplinaryteam, we envisage the physician associate will be involved in acute visits,frailty management, chronic disease management, care home visits, advanced careplanning and palliation, whilst working within their scope of practice.

Appropriate supervision and support will be available to PhysicianAssociates.

Opportunities to take part in quality improvement projects will beavailable.

We welcome applications from experienced as well as newlyqualified physician associates for this role and will continue to support PAswith access to monthly teaching session, CBD and development. Peer to peersupport and mentorship will be available for all PAs employed within the PCN.For those new to primary care the engagement with preceptorship would besupported.

Main duties of the job

Provide first point of contact for patients presenting withundifferentiated, undiagnosed problems, utilising history-taking, physicalexaminations and clinical decision-making skills to establish a workingdiagnosis and management plan in partnership with the patient.

Examine, assess and diagnose patients and provide clinical care/management as required.

Review, analyse and action diagnostic test results.Collect/request pathology specimens as required.

Support patients in the use of their prescribed medicines orover the counter medicines (within own scope of practice).

Deliver integrated patient centred-care through appropriateworking with the wider multi-disciplinary team and social care networks.

Ensure continuity of care, arranging follow-up consultations orreviews as necessary.

Provide routine care to patients as required in accordance withclinical based evidence, NICE and the NSF.

Utilise clinical guidelines, promote evidence-based practice andpartake in clinical audits, significant event reviews and other research andanalysis tasks.

Ensure that they adhere to the relevant patient group directivesand local clinical pathways at all times.

About us

The physician associate will have access to both an education andclinical supervisor within their GP base. The level and type of supervisionwill be dependent on the post holders skills and knowledge and determined bythe organisations clinical governance arrangements.

Main Purpose of the Job

The physician associate will be required to work autonomously inthe practice, providing a range of services such as assessment, diagnosis,treatment, telephone triage, and clinical decision-making and referringpatients appropriately.

Job description

Job responsibilities

The following are the core responsibilities of the PhysicianAssociate. There may be, on occasion, a requirement to carry out other tasks;this will be dependent upon factors such as workload and staffing levels. ThePhysician Associate will work within their scope of clinical practiceand:

General practice

Provide first point of contact for patients presenting withundifferentiated, undiagnosed problems, utilising history-taking, physicalexaminations and clinical decision-making skills to establish a workingdiagnosis and management plan in partnership with the patient (and their carerswhere applicable).

Examine, assess and diagnose patients and provide clinical care/management as required.

Recognise, assess and refer patients presenting with mentalhealth needs.

Review, analyse and action diagnostic test results.Collect/request pathology specimens as required.

Support patients in the use of their prescribed medicines orover the counter medicines (within own scope of practice).

Review the effectiveness of the treatment provided, makingchanges where necessary to improve patient outcomes

Deliver integrated patient centred-care through appropriateworking with the wider multi-disciplinary team and social care networks.

Play an active role in the management of patients with long termconditions

Deliver opportunistic health promotion where appropriate

Ensure continuity of care, arranging follow-up consultations orreviews as necessary.

Liaise with external services/agencies to ensure that the patientis supported appropriately (vulnerable patients etc).

Understand practice and local policies for substance abuse andaddictive behaviour, referring patients appropriately.

Provide routine care to patients as required in accordance withclinical based evidence, NICE and the NSF.

Utilise clinical guidelines, promote evidence-based practice andpartake in clinical audits, significant event reviews and other research andanalysis tasks.

Ensure that they adhere to the relevant patient group directivesand local clinical pathways at all times.

Support the clinical team with all safeguarding matters, inaccordance with local and national policies.

Carry out immunisations as required

Chaperone patients where necessary

Maintain accurate clinical records in conjunction with currentlegislation.

Ensure read codes are used effectively.

Work within scope of practice, and seekassistance/support when required
